WebCAD 支持多种 CAD 实体类型的创建与操作。
| 示例 | 描述 | 链接 |
|---|
| 创建所有实体 | 表格展示所有实体类型 | 在线演示{target="_blank"} |
| 示例 | 描述 | 链接 |
|---|
| 创建直线 | LineEnt 基本创建示例 | 在线演示{target="_blank"} |
| 直线属性 | 获取直线长度、角度、起终点 | 在线演示{target="_blank"} |
| 直线变换 | 移动、旋转、缩放、镜像、拉伸操作 | 在线演示{target="_blank"} |
| 颜色设置 | 使用索引颜色和 RGB 真彩色创建直线 | 在线演示{target="_blank"} |
| 示例 | 描述 | 链接 |
|---|
| 默认线型 | 显示系统内置的所有线型样式 | 在线演示{target="_blank"} |
| 创建线型 | 使用 LinetypeDefinition 创建自定义线型 | 在线演示{target="_blank"} |
| 加载 LIN 文件 | 从 AutoCAD .lin 格式字符串加载线型 | 在线演示{target="_blank"} |
| 线型管理器 | LinetypeManager 的完整 API 用法 | 在线演示{target="_blank"} |
| 线型比例 | lineTypeScale 参数对线型显示的影响 | 在线演示{target="_blank"} |
| 复杂线型 | 创建带文字和形状符号的复杂线型 | 在线演示{target="_blank"} |
| 示例 | 描述 | 链接 |
|---|
| 创建圆 | CircleEnt 基本创建示例 | 在线演示{target="_blank"} |
| 圆属性 | 获取圆半径、面积、周长 | 在线演示{target="_blank"} |
| 圆变换 | 移动、缩放、镜像操作 | 在线演示{target="_blank"} |
| 示例 | 描述 | 链接 |
|---|
| 创建圆弧 | ArcEnt 基本创建示例 | 在线演示{target="_blank"} |
| 三点圆弧 | initBy3Pt 方法创建圆弧 | 在线演示{target="_blank"} |
| 圆弧属性 | 展示圆弧的各种属性和计算值 | 在线演示{target="_blank"} |
| 圆弧变换 | 移动、旋转、缩放、镜像操作 | 在线演示{target="_blank"} |
| 示例 | 描述 | 链接 |
|---|
| 创建多段线 | 简化接口用法 | 在线演示{target="_blank"} |
| 绘制矩形 | 使用简化接口创建闭合多段线 | 在线演示{target="_blank"} |
| 带圆弧多段线 | 使用简化接口设置凸度参数 | 在线演示{target="_blank"} |
| 多段线属性 | 展示多段线的各种属性和计算值 | 在线演示{target="_blank"} |
| 示例 | 描述 | 链接 |
|---|
| 创建椭圆 | EllipseEnt 基本创建示例 | 在线演示{target="_blank"} |
| 椭圆弧 | 创建部分椭圆(椭圆弧) | 在线演示{target="_blank"} |
| 椭圆变换 | 移动、旋转、缩放、镜像操作 | 在线演示{target="_blank"} |
| 示例 | 描述 | 链接 |
|---|
| 单行文字 | TextEnt 基础与属性示例 | 在线演示{target="_blank"} |
| 多行文字 | MTextEnt 基础与格式示例 | 在线演示{target="_blank"} |
| 文字样式 | 设置文字的各种样式属性 | 在线演示{target="_blank"} |
| 字体设置 | TrueType 字体 (woff/ttf) 与 SHX 字体示例 | 在线演示{target="_blank"} |
| 示例 | 描述 | 链接 |
|---|
| 创建填充 | HatchEnt 基本用法 | 在线演示{target="_blank"} |
| 填充图案表 | 展示所有内置填充图案 | 在线演示{target="_blank"} |
| 填充边界 | 不同类型的填充边界创建方法 | 在线演示{target="_blank"} |
| 自定义填充图案 | 注册自定义图案并自动计算比例 | 在线演示{target="_blank"} |
| 示例 | 描述 | 链接 |
|---|
| 图像插入 | IMAGE 插入图像示例(含 base64) | 在线演示{target="_blank"} |
| 示例 | 描述 | 链接 |
|---|
| 创建块定义 | BlockDefinition 示例 | 在线演示{target="_blank"} |
| 插入块 | InsertEnt 块引用示例 | 在线演示{target="_blank"} |
| 块炸开 | 将块引用炸开为独立实体 | 在线演示{target="_blank"} |
| 块属性文字 | InsertEnt 属性定义和属性值示例 | 在线演示{target="_blank"} |
| 块统计 | COUNTBLOCK 统计块使用次数示例 | 在线演示{target="_blank"} |
| 块替换 | REPLACEBLOCK 替换块引用示例 | 在线演示{target="_blank"} |
| 示例 | 描述 | 链接 |
|---|
| 创建点实体 | DotEnt 基本创建示例 | 在线演示{target="_blank"} |
| 点阵图案 | 使用点实体创建图案 | 在线演示{target="_blank"} |
| 点实体变换 | 移动、旋转、缩放操作 | 在线演示{target="_blank"} |
| 示例 | 描述 | 链接 |
|---|
| 创建射线 | RayEnt 基本创建示例 | 在线演示{target="_blank"} |
| 射线变换 | 移动、旋转、缩放、镜像操作 | 在线演示{target="_blank"} |
| 创建构造线 | XLineEnt 基本创建示例 | 在线演示{target="_blank"} |
| 构造线网格 | 使用构造线创建参考网格 | 在线演示{target="_blank"} |
| 示例 | 描述 | 链接 |
|---|
| 创建实体填充 | SolidEnt 基本创建示例 | 在线演示{target="_blank"} |
| 实体填充箭头 | 使用 SolidEnt 创建各种箭头形状 | 在线演示{target="_blank"} |
| 实体填充变换 | 移动、旋转、缩放、镜像操作 | 在线演示{target="_blank"} |
| 示例 | 描述 | 链接 |
|---|
| 创建样条曲线 | SplineEnt 基本创建示例 | 在线演示{target="_blank"} |
| 闭合样条曲线 | 创建首尾相连的样条曲线 | 在线演示{target="_blank"} |
| 带权重样条曲线 | 控制点权重影响曲线形状 | 在线演示{target="_blank"} |
| 样条曲线变换 | 移动、旋转、缩放、镜像操作 | 在线演示{target="_blank"} |
| 示例 | 描述 | 链接 |
|---|
| 线性标注 | LinearDimensionEnt 基本创建示例 | 在线演示{target="_blank"} |
| 半径标注 | RadialDimensionEnt 创建示例 | 在线演示{target="_blank"} |
| 标注样式 | 设置标注文字、箭头等样式 | 在线演示{target="_blank"} |
| 对齐标注 | AlignedDimensionEnt 测量倾斜距离 | 在线演示{target="_blank"} |
| 角度标注 | AngleDimensionEnt 角度标注示例 | 在线演示{target="_blank"} |
| 直径标注 | DiametricDimensionEnt 直径标注示例 | 在线演示{target="_blank"} |
| 弧长标注 | ArcDimensionEnt 弧长标注示例 | 在线演示{target="_blank"} |
| 坐标标注 | OrdinateDimensionEnt 坐标标注示例 | 在线演示{target="_blank"} |
| 相联标注 | Associative Dimension 关联标注示例 | 在线演示{target="_blank"} |
| 示例 | 描述 | 链接 |
|---|
| 创建双线 | DLine 双线绘制示例 | 在线演示{target="_blank"} |
| 创建圆环 | Donut 圆环实体示例 | 在线演示{target="_blank"} |
| 创建圆角矩形 | Box 圆角矩形示例 | 在线演示{target="_blank"} |
| 创建正多边形 | Polygon 正多边形示例 | 在线演示{target="_blank"} |
| 创建平行四边形 | Parallelogram 平行四边形示例 | 在线演示{target="_blank"} |
| 创建像素点 | PixelPointEnt 像素点示例 | 在线演示{target="_blank"} |
| 多重引线 | MLeaderEnt 多重引线标注示例 | 在线演示{target="_blank"} |